CSS에서 내부 HTML을 기반으로 요소 선택
질문:
어떻게 사용할 수 있나요? 내부 HTML을 기반으로 요소를 타겟팅하는 CSS 선택기? 특히 다음 HTML을 고려해보세요.
<a href="example1.com">innerHTML1</a> <a href="example2.com">innerHTML2</a> <a href="example3.com">innerHTML3</a>
두 번째 내부 HTML을 기반으로 하는 CSS 선택기를 사용하는 요소(innerHTML2)?
답변:
안타깝게도 CSS만 사용하여 내부 HTML을 기반으로 요소를 타겟팅하는 것은 불가능합니다. . a[value=innerHTML2]의 값 속성은 앵커 태그의 내부 HTML을 참조하지 않습니다.
대안:
다음을 기반으로 요소의 스타일을 지정하려는 경우 내부 HTML을 사용하는 경우 jQuery와 같은 JavaScript 프레임워크 사용을 고려할 수 있습니다. 다음은 두 번째 요소:
$('a:contains("innerHTML2")')
위 내용은 CSS 선택기가 내부 HTML을 기반으로 요소를 대상으로 지정할 수 있습니까?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!